On Mon, 16 Jun 2025 18:18:18 +0200 Matthieu Baerts wrote:
> > The ALL_TESTS issue is not the end of it either. We use helpers that
> > call stuff indirectly all over the place. defer, in_ns... It would make
> > sense to me to just disable SC2317 in NIPA runs. Or maybe even put it in
> > net/forwarding/.shellcheckrc. Pretty much all those tests are written in
> > a style that will hit these issues.
>
> In this case, I think it would be better to add this .shellcheckrc file
> in net/forwarding. If you modify NIPA, I don't think people will know
> what is allowed or not, or what command line to use, no?
Let's do both? I disabled it to NIPA over the weekend.
